Perdonate l'ignoranza ma come posso validare un form utilizzanto un pulsante grafico ed un file esterno?
grazie
Perdonate l'ignoranza ma come posso validare un form utilizzanto un pulsante grafico ed un file esterno?
grazie
il file esterno ha semplicemente i controlli ke convalidano il form
<script language="JavaScript" src="fileesterno.js"></script>
lo rikiami così nella <head>
[img]...[/img]
credo possa andare bene....
Heaven's closed. Hell sold out.
Linux 2.6.26-2-amd64
Debian squeeze
Per il pulsante grafico:Originariamente inviato da 99eros9
Perdonate l'ignoranza ma come posso validare un form utilizzanto un pulsante grafico ed un file esterno?
grazie
<input type="image" src="immagine.gif">
Ciao !
Ho provato, ma invia i dati senza effettuare i controlli e comunque ci sarebbero altri due problemini:
il primo è che il puntatore del mouse, logicamente non cambia quando va sopra il pulsante e poi il secondo, molto più importante, è il seguente:
Quando viene caricata la pagina, i pulsanti di invio sono, in realtà, 2:
a seconda dei casi che si potranno verificare verrà caricato l'uno o l'altro pulsante.
Nel primo caso, il pulsante (A) dovrà effettuare il controllo dei dati e quindi inviarli ad una pagina di elaborazione in ASP;
nel secondo caso, il pulsante (B) oltre ad eseguire il controllo, dovrà concatenare ai dati inviati alla stessa pagina ASP anche un ulteriore parametro (in queryString). Se lo avessi fatto nella stessa pagina compilando due funzioni diverse sarebbe stato tutto più semplice ma troppo lungo.
La mia domanda è:
è possibile sfruttare uno script esterno per il controllo dei dati del modulo e successivamente eseguire una specifica funzione (a scelta)dalla pagina contenente il form da validare?
Nella mia ignoranza ho anche pensato di inserire due funzioni (X e Y) nel file esterno e poi richiamarle dai pulsanti rispettivamente con:
<img....>
<img....>
Ma sembra non sia possibile e che sono totalmente fuori strada.
Grazie comunque per l'aiuto.
un problema lo risolviamo!Originariamente inviato da 99eros9
Ho provato, ma invia i dati senza effettuare i controlli e comunque ci sarebbero altri due problemini:
il primo è che il puntatore del mouse, logicamente non cambia quando va sopra il pulsante
<input type.... class="mouse">
css:
.mouse
{
CURSOR: hand;
}
Heaven's closed. Hell sold out.
Linux 2.6.26-2-amd64
Debian squeeze
Grazie a tutti però ho risolto nel modo in cui avevo pensato inizialmente.
Tutto dipendeva dalla posizione in cui andavo a richiamare il file esterno .js nell'head del documento. Non immaginavo fosse così importante....
Naturalmente mi avete insegnato valide alternative, come sempre!